Ecosyste.ms: Issues

An open API service for providing issue and pull request metadata for open source projects.

GitHub / ziglang/zig issues and pull requests

#21345 - Proposal: give functions with inferred error sets a more sane type name

Issue - State: open - Opened by NicoElbers 3 months ago - 2 comments
Labels: proposal

#21344 - sync Aro dependency

Pull Request - State: closed - Opened by Vexu 3 months ago - 2 comments

#21344 - sync Aro dependency

Pull Request - State: closed - Opened by Vexu 3 months ago - 2 comments

#21342 - std: add arch bits for s390x-linux

Pull Request - State: closed - Opened by nektro 3 months ago - 1 comment

#21341 - Pointer Arithmetic with If Ternary Expression Fails with `+=` Operator

Issue - State: closed - Opened by evanlin96069 3 months ago - 1 comment
Labels: bug, frontend

#21341 - Pointer Arithmetic with If Ternary Expression Fails with `+=` Operator

Issue - State: closed - Opened by evanlin96069 3 months ago - 1 comment
Labels: bug, frontend

#21340 - Provide tests closing old issues

Pull Request - State: closed - Opened by RetroDev256 3 months ago - 4 comments

#21340 - Provide tests closing old issues

Pull Request - State: closed - Opened by RetroDev256 3 months ago - 4 comments

#21339 - `test`: Re-enable a bunch of behavior tests with LLVM.

Pull Request - State: closed - Opened by alexrp 3 months ago

#21338 - LLVM 19: Attempt to get CI green

Pull Request - State: closed - Opened by alexrp 3 months ago - 3 comments

#21338 - LLVM 19: Attempt to get CI green

Pull Request - State: closed - Opened by alexrp 3 months ago - 3 comments

#21336 - cannot convert from f16 to i32 when targeting loongarch64

Issue - State: open - Opened by nektro 3 months ago - 6 comments
Labels: bug, upstream, backend-llvm, arch-loongarch64

#21336 - cannot convert from f16 to i32 when targeting loongarch64

Issue - State: open - Opened by nektro 3 months ago - 6 comments
Labels: bug, upstream, backend-llvm, arch-loongarch64

#21331 - Prevent failure with empty struct in `std.meta.DeclEnum`

Pull Request - State: closed - Opened by bobf 3 months ago

#21329 - Remove `s390x-linux-gnu` assembler workarounds with LLVM 20

Issue - State: open - Opened by alexrp 3 months ago
Labels: bug, upstream, backend-llvm, arch-s390x

#21324 - Generic types can bypass eval branch quota, segfaulting compiler

Issue - State: open - Opened by MikeInnes 3 months ago - 7 comments
Labels: bug, frontend

#21323 - Dwarf: implement more decls

Pull Request - State: closed - Opened by jacobly0 3 months ago

#21316 - Zig fetch: Unable to discover remote git server capabilities

Issue - State: open - Opened by kassane 3 months ago - 2 comments
Labels: bug

#21315 - Can't build a working program for MIPS32 mips-linux-musl target triple with `zig cc`

Issue - State: open - Opened by InBetweenNames 3 months ago - 4 comments
Labels: bug, upstream, arch-mips

#21309 - Fix: `dependsOnSystemLibrary`

Pull Request - State: open - Opened by kassane 3 months ago

#21306 - std.fs: support `Lock.none` on Windows

Pull Request - State: open - Opened by DivergentClouds 3 months ago - 3 comments

#21296 - Invalid `try` operand type deduction

Issue - State: closed - Opened by amp-59 3 months ago - 2 comments
Labels: bug

#21295 - std.fmt: Update casing of a few functions to match naming style guide

Pull Request - State: closed - Opened by linusg 3 months ago - 1 comment

#21295 - std.fmt: Update casing of a few functions to match naming style guide

Pull Request - State: closed - Opened by linusg 3 months ago - 1 comment

#21290 - `std.equalRange`: Compute lower and upper bounds simultaneously.

Pull Request - State: open - Opened by LucasSantos91 3 months ago - 5 comments

#21289 - decl literal cannot be used with `catch` operator

Issue - State: closed - Opened by paperdave 3 months ago - 2 comments
Labels: question

#21288 - Bitrotted compiler tests

Issue - State: open - Opened by linusg 3 months ago - 4 comments
Labels: bug

#21287 - Replace deprecated default initializations with decl literals

Pull Request - State: closed - Opened by linusg 3 months ago - 4 comments

#21286 - disallow left over bits in packed unions

Pull Request - State: closed - Opened by Rexicon226 3 months ago - 1 comment

#21286 - disallow left over bits in packed unions

Pull Request - State: closed - Opened by Rexicon226 3 months ago - 1 comment

#21276 - `fchmodat smoke test` fails on `mips(el)-linux-gnueabi(hf)`

Issue - State: closed - Opened by alexrp 3 months ago - 1 comment
Labels: bug, standard library, arch-mips

#21273 - fix compile error on the `std.c.EXC.MASK` field on darwin

Pull Request - State: open - Opened by srijan-paul 3 months ago - 4 comments

#21273 - fix compile error on the `std.c.EXC.MASK` field on darwin

Pull Request - State: open - Opened by srijan-paul 3 months ago - 4 comments

#21272 - std.os.windows: fix regressions that are causing compile errors

Pull Request - State: closed - Opened by yhyadev 3 months ago

#21271 - std.valgrind: fix regressions that are causing compile errors

Pull Request - State: closed - Opened by yhyadev 3 months ago

#21269 - Fix soft float support, split musl triples by float ABI, and enable CI

Pull Request - State: open - Opened by alexrp 3 months ago - 2 comments

#21269 - Fix soft float support, split musl triples by float ABI, and enable CI

Pull Request - State: closed - Opened by alexrp 3 months ago - 3 comments

#21266 - Compiler crash bit-shifting undefined at comptime

Issue - State: open - Opened by Validark 3 months ago - 1 comment
Labels: bug, frontend

#21263 - Some fixes for `thumb-linux-*` support

Pull Request - State: closed - Opened by alexrp 3 months ago - 1 comment

#21258 - Size saving opportunity in glibc include directories

Issue - State: open - Opened by alexrp 3 months ago - 2 comments
Labels: enhancement

#21257 - compiler: implement labeled switch/continue

Pull Request - State: closed - Opened by mlugg 3 months ago - 5 comments
Labels: release notes

#21257 - compiler: implement labeled switch/continue

Pull Request - State: closed - Opened by mlugg 3 months ago - 6 comments
Labels: release notes

#21256 - Improve efficiency of buffered_reader.

Pull Request - State: closed - Opened by LucasSantos91 3 months ago - 9 comments
Labels: enhancement, optimization, standard library, release notes

#21246 - Less basic fuzzer

Pull Request - State: open - Opened by ProkopRandacek 3 months ago - 9 comments

#21245 - Incorrect behavior on C function that returns struct which contains array of one or two doubles

Issue - State: open - Opened by tatjam 3 months ago - 4 comments
Labels: bug, arch-x86_64, arch-aarch64, arch-wasm, miscompilation, arch-riscv

#21233 - Compiler crash when using stackFallbackAllocator.get() during comptime

Issue - State: closed - Opened by Ratakor 3 months ago - 1 comment
Labels: bug

#21232 - zig don't get remote package rootpath

Issue - State: closed - Opened by kassane 3 months ago - 14 comments
Labels: bug

#21231 - AstGen: disallow fields and decls from sharing names

Pull Request - State: closed - Opened by mlugg 3 months ago - 3 comments
Labels: breaking, release notes

#21225 - std: update `std.builtin.Type` fields to follow naming conventions

Pull Request - State: closed - Opened by mlugg 3 months ago - 4 comments
Labels: breaking, release notes

#21225 - std: update `std.builtin.Type` fields to follow naming conventions

Pull Request - State: closed - Opened by mlugg 3 months ago - 4 comments
Labels: breaking, release notes

#21215 - Re-enable FastISel for MIPS O32 with LLVM 20

Issue - State: open - Opened by alexrp 3 months ago - 2 comments
Labels: bug, upstream, arch-mips, backend-llvm

#21215 - Re-enable FastISel for MIPS O32 with LLVM 20

Issue - State: open - Opened by alexrp 3 months ago - 2 comments
Labels: bug, upstream, arch-mips, backend-llvm

#21214 - Implement `@branchHint` and new `@export` usage

Pull Request - State: closed - Opened by mlugg 3 months ago - 2 comments
Labels: breaking, release notes

#21214 - Implement `@branchHint` and new `@export` usage

Pull Request - State: closed - Opened by mlugg 3 months ago - 2 comments
Labels: breaking, release notes

#21214 - Implement `@branchHint` and new `@export` usage

Pull Request - State: closed - Opened by mlugg 3 months ago - 2 comments
Labels: breaking, release notes

#21205 - Proposal: clarify comptime_float semantics

Issue - State: open - Opened by ianprime0509 3 months ago - 1 comment
Labels: proposal

#21184 - Cannot run bootstrapped build on mipsel-linux

Issue - State: closed - Opened by The-King-of-Toasters 3 months ago - 18 comments
Labels: bug, arch-mips

#21184 - Cannot run bootstrapped build on mipsel-linux

Issue - State: closed - Opened by The-King-of-Toasters 3 months ago - 18 comments
Labels: bug, arch-mips

#21183 - [WIP] LLVM 19

Pull Request - State: open - Opened by alexrp 3 months ago - 11 comments

#21181 - fix THREAD_STATE_NONE on darwin

Pull Request - State: closed - Opened by mattheson 3 months ago

#21159 - Compiler crash: panic: access of union field 'func' while field 'cau' is active

Issue - State: open - Opened by ehaas 3 months ago - 1 comment
Labels: bug, frontend

#21148 - introduce @branchHint builtin

Issue - State: closed - Opened by andrewrk 3 months ago - 12 comments
Labels: breaking, proposal, accepted

#21148 - introduce @branchHint builtin

Issue - State: closed - Opened by andrewrk 3 months ago - 12 comments
Labels: breaking, proposal, accepted

#21148 - introduce @branchHint builtin

Issue - State: closed - Opened by andrewrk 3 months ago - 12 comments
Labels: breaking, proposal, accepted

#21122 - Build/Options: fix for struct array/slice and optional struct options

Pull Request - State: open - Opened by tw4452852 3 months ago - 3 comments

#21122 - Build/Options: fix for struct array/slice and optional struct options

Pull Request - State: open - Opened by tw4452852 3 months ago - 3 comments

#21120 - doc: clarify build.zig.zon urls should point to immutable data

Pull Request - State: open - Opened by marler8997 3 months ago - 9 comments

#21096 - Remove "slow target" flag for `mips(el)-linux` targets in tests with LLVM 20

Issue - State: open - Opened by alexrp 3 months ago - 2 comments
Labels: upstream, backend-llvm

#21077 - std.math: change gcd's implementation to use Stein's algorithm instead of Euclid's

Pull Request - State: closed - Opened by Fri3dNstuff 3 months ago - 16 comments
Labels: enhancement, optimization, standard library, release notes

#21067 - comments for waitgroup usage

Pull Request - State: open - Opened by dbubel 3 months ago - 3 comments

#21059 - update CI tarballs to LLVM 18.1.8

Pull Request - State: closed - Opened by andrewrk 3 months ago - 2 comments

#21051 - `behavior.vector.test.vector float operators` causes LLVM assertion failure on `mips*-linux-*`

Issue - State: open - Opened by alexrp 3 months ago - 1 comment
Labels: bug, upstream, arch-mips, backend-llvm

#21050 - `behavior.union.test.reinterpret packed union` fails on `mips-linux-*`, `powerpc-linux-*`, `powerpc64-linux-*`

Issue - State: open - Opened by alexrp 3 months ago - 2 comments
Labels: bug, arch-mips, backend-llvm

#21050 - `behavior.union.test.reinterpret packed union` fails on big endian targets

Issue - State: open - Opened by alexrp 3 months ago - 2 comments
Labels: bug, arch-mips, backend-llvm

#21044 - files extracted from zips are missing execute permissions

Issue - State: open - Opened by travisstaloch 3 months ago - 3 comments
Labels: enhancement, contributor friendly, standard library

#21037 - `std.Target`: Rewrite DynamicLinker.standard() and fill in some missing details.

Pull Request - State: open - Opened by alexrp 4 months ago - 1 comment

#21037 - `std.Target`: Rewrite DynamicLinker.standard() and fill in some missing details.

Pull Request - State: closed - Opened by alexrp 4 months ago - 3 comments

#21025 - libfuzzer: Track the rate of fuzzing in cycles/s.

Pull Request - State: open - Opened by gcoakes 4 months ago - 2 comments

#21025 - libfuzzer: Track the rate of fuzzing in cycles/s.

Pull Request - State: closed - Opened by gcoakes 4 months ago - 2 comments

#20981 - separate the build runner process from the configure process

Issue - State: open - Opened by andrewrk 4 months ago - 3 comments
Labels: enhancement, breaking, zig build system

#20914 - Add length range to FuzzInputOptions

Pull Request - State: open - Opened by AdamGoertz 4 months ago - 9 comments

#20914 - Add length range to FuzzInputOptions

Pull Request - State: open - Opened by AdamGoertz 4 months ago - 9 comments

#20874 - zig build: add env_map entries to hash for Step.Run

Pull Request - State: open - Opened by dweiller 4 months ago - 1 comment

#20847 - ICE: deref of null value in llvm.updateExports

Issue - State: closed - Opened by kristoff-it 4 months ago - 6 comments
Labels: bug, os-macos, backend-llvm, regression

#20845 - debug.zig: Make it build with 'other' target OS

Pull Request - State: open - Opened by rootbeer 4 months ago - 6 comments

#20738 - coercion of mutable pointers' child type causes a soundness issue

Issue - State: open - Opened by Fri3dNstuff 4 months ago - 2 comments
Labels: bug, miscompilation

#20711 - HelloWorld binary size increased a lot in recent Zig versions

Issue - State: open - Opened by hronro 4 months ago - 4 comments
Labels: contributor friendly, optimization, regression

#20689 - Crosscompile CGO using zig 0.12 or newer

Issue - State: open - Opened by ostcar 4 months ago - 5 comments
Labels: bug, zig cc, regression

#20687 - Add option to specify language of CSourceFiles

Pull Request - State: open - Opened by GalaxyShard 4 months ago - 4 comments

#20671 - Unable to use `callconv(.Interrupt)` for riscv targets

Issue - State: closed - Opened by akiroz 4 months ago - 5 comments
Labels: enhancement, frontend, arch-riscv

#20663 - Remove `usingnamespace`

Issue - State: open - Opened by mlugg 4 months ago - 78 comments
Labels: breaking, proposal